Abstract:
Process for dyeing or printing NH-containing fibers with reactive dyestuffs containing at least one group reactive to the NH-group and more than 1 sulfonic acid group comprising adding as surface active compounds aminoxides with at least eight carbon atoms in one and the same radical.
Abstract:
Water soluble polyamides which are obtained by reacting aliphatic polyamines with Alpha , Beta -unsaturated aliphatic monocarboxylic acids or aliphatic polycarboxylic acids optionally containing hetero atoms or their functional derivatives capable of forming amides are used as agents for preventing damage to protein-containing fiber materials or mixtures of such materials by adding the polyamides to an acidic aqueous medium used to treat said fibers.
